In the poem “Not Waving but Drowning” the character appears to be someone who has always been the life of the party, but deep down inside, he is drowning and dying slowly. The narrator states “But still he lay there moaning/ I was much further out than you thought/ And not waving but drowning” (Smith lines 2-4). The main character appears to be having fun but in reality, he is crying for help, and no one even notices. Just because people may seem happy, does not make them happy. The main character from “Richard Cory”, is the wealthiest man in town. He, too, went unnoticed, but was well recognized. The author lets us know that looks can be deceiving; “In fine, we thought he was everything/ To make us wish that we were in his place” (Robinson 11-12). The author goes on to write “And Richard Cory, one calm summer night/ Went home and put a bullet through his head” (Robinson 15-16). The townspeople thought he was so happy because he had money and was so graceful. He was actually depressed. Nothing triggered him to kill himself because it was on a calm summer night.
